Which sentence demonstrates correct use of the semicolon?
Ket [755]
The correct answer is - Sara suddenly became very ill; therefore, she went to see her doctor.
A semicolon is used to separate two sentences, two separate but also connected thoughts. It should come naturally as a pause within a sentence, which is why the first three options are incorrect as they break up the sentence in grammatically incorrect locations.
